**What You Will Do**:
- Serve as Chairperson of the JPS committee and coordinate all OMM Book 6 content.
- Act as the main point of contact for condition-based monitoring programs and the implementation of standards.
- Serve as the Subject Matter Expert (SME) for job plan content, ensuring it meets governance standards.
- Act as SME for asset registry requirements for maintenance and operations.
- Ensure adherence to Canadian and US Federal and Provincial Laws and Regulations in maintenance activities.
- Support field operations during compliance audits.
**Who You Are**:
- Related university degree with seven-plus years of experience OR ten-plus years of previous field operations experience, OR an equivalent mix of formal education and experience.
- Professional Designation in Maintenance Management (MMP, CMRP, Maintenance & Planning) is preferred.
- Advanced knowledge of Maximo and Accelerator KMS is preferred.
- Excellent interpersonal, leadership, and communication skills.
- Ability to communicate and present technical and non-technical information effectively.
**Working Conditions**:
- The role is primarily based in an office environment, with moderate travel to regions, conferences, and committee meetings.
- Flexibility is required to manage work priorities, field schedules, and partner requirements.
- You will need to maintain focus and drive to complete numerous activities with limited resources and facilitate collaboration in work-team settings.
**Physical Requirements include but are not limited to**:
Grasping, kneeling, light - moderate lifting (objects up to 20 pounds), reaching above shoulder, repetitive motion, typing, sitting, standing, visual requirement (able to see screens, detect color coding, read fine print), hearing requirement and the ability to sit at a computer for long periods of time.

**Salary range**:
- $94,000-$127,000/yr
**Benefits - Regular Employees**
- PPO & HSO plans (only HSA if participate in the HSO)
- 12 US Paid Holidays + PTO
- Family Illness days
- Military Leave
**Savings**
- 401k match 6% match
**Pension**
- Regular full-time and part-time employees can participate in the plan immediately upon hire
- Cash Balance Pension plan, Enbridge makes the contributions (not vested until after 3 years)
- The plan is fully paid for by Enbridge, no employee contributions
- Pay credits are between 4% and 11% of eligible earnings, based on age and service
